Workplace Investigation Report (MA)

Massachusetts

A workplace investigation report is used to document inappropriate behavior, safety issues, policy violations, or any other type of workplace misconduct.

This form ensures all relevant details are recorded, including incident descriptions and employee and witness statements. This facilitates decision-making regarding disciplinary actions and helps maintain compliance and fairness in handling workplace issues.

This form should be reviewed together with your employee handbook and other existing company policies. It's designed to be used with the Progressive Discipline Policy, Written Warning, Final Disciplinary Notice, and Termination Notice. This is not intended for employees covered by a collective bargaining agreement.

You should review any applicable laws in your jurisdiction and consult experienced counsel for legal advice, especially if it relates to sexual harassment, discrimination, and retaliation.
